########## src/bthread/task_control.cpp: ########## @@ -524,12 +525,29 @@ void TaskControl::print_rq_sizes(std::ostream& os) { double TaskControl::get_cumulated_worker_time() { int64_t cputime_ns = 0; + int64_t now = butil::cpuwide_time_ns(); BAIDU_SCOPED_LOCK(_modify_group_mutex); for_each_task_group([&](TaskGroup* g) { if (g) { - cputime_ns += g->_cumulated_cputime_ns; + // With the acquire-release atomic operation, the CPU time of the bthread is + // only calculated once through `_cumulated_cputime_ns' or `_last_run_ns'. + cputime_ns += g->_cumulated_cputime_ns.load(butil::memory_order_acquire); + // The bthread is still running on the worker, + // so we need to add the elapsed time since it started. + // In extreme cases, before getting `_last_run_ns_in_tc', + // `_last_run_ns_in_tc' may have been updated multiple times, + // and `cputime_ns' will miss some cpu time, which is ok. + int64_t last_run_ns = g->_last_run_ns; + if (last_run_ns > _last_get_cumulated_time_ns) { + g->_last_run_ns_in_tc = last_run_ns; + cputime_ns += now - last_run_ns; + } else if (last_run_ns == g->_last_run_ns_in_tc) { + // The bthread is still running on the same worker. + cputime_ns += now - last_run_ns; + } Review Comment: Perhaps we can use the implicit feature of modern CPUs that 128-bit aligned load/store operations are atomic to implement atomic operations on combination of `_cumulated_cputime_ns` and `_last_run_ns`. x86_64: `_mm_load_si128`, `_mm_store_si128` Arm and later: `vld1q_s64` For scenarios that do not support 128-bit atomic operations, use the current PR implementation without lock. For a monitoring item used for debugging, this trade-off is reasonable. -- This is an automated message from the Apache Git Service.
